Imagery characteristics
• GSD LESS than 6cm• RMSE less than 8cm horizontal• RMSE less than 20cm vertical• Max 15% building lean• Bit depth• Pan ban + other bands aligned

Shoreline coverage – same as last year• (12) Shoreline coverage - Flight lines running parallel to a
shoreline may be repositioned to reduce the proportion of water covered provided the coverage extends beyond the limit of any land feature by at least 30 per-cent of the strip width. The City desires to have no black Pixels within the two kilometre buffer around the City. The lake area beyond the 30 per-cent strip width may be flown at a “higher altitude” with less overlap to ensure that no “black or null Pixels” exist within lake side 2km buffer in the final orthoimages. Vendor is to ensure that these coarser lake only images are colour balanced to the higher resolution imager where they overlap the 30 per-cent strip. GSD, horizontal accuracy, and vertical accuracy will be relaxed between the 30 per-cent strip and the 2km buffer over water. Optionally, existing lesser resolution Raster Imagery may be used in this area only provided it was captured at or near the time as the flight for this RFQ. The objective is to be able to see sediment patterns out to the 2km buffer

Key deliverable: images stereo-pairs in APS-DVP v7 format along with .par and .dat files:
• the panchromatic band Stereo Models shall be provided as a separate set
• the 64 bit depth RGBir Stereo Models shall be provided as a separate set
• both sets must be aligned and coincident and have the same spatial accuracy and GSD
• PAR/DAT files deemed non-standard – need One other transformation set for BAE, ERDAS, DAT-EM, other
